Handover — nightly search reindex (Findrel service)

Taking over from me: the nightly reindex on Findrel kicks off at 02:10 and usually finishes by 04:30. It rebuilds the product and docs indexes in sequence; if the docs index stalls, kill it and rerun only that stage — a full rerun wastes hours. Watch disk on the warm tier; it fills around month-end. If the coordinator node dies mid-run, you'll need to restore its state from the sealed snapshot, which prompts for a passphrase. It is noted below for future maintainers.

strongbox words: alddor-rusius-belox-gorys-holius-oliix-ralmir-lamvan-briius-fraion-zormir-novwyn-zormir-holmir

### Step 4: Point GiftNote at the new relay

Almost there. The Harrowdale receipt mailer now sends through the internal relay instead of the legacy SMTP box, so retries and bounces behave differently. Drain the old queue first, then restart the workers. Once that's done, update your environment to match these values.

deployment values, fahap-hahaf:
[casdor]
port = 9200
region = south-2
host = casdor.qirvanworks.corp
timeout_ms = 3000
retries = 4

**Ticket: Intermittent connection failures during log compaction**

Brokerpipe workers drop connections whenever the compaction pass on the queue topic runs longer than 30 seconds. We suspect the compactor holds the metadata lock while rewriting segments, starving the health-check thread. Mira reproduced it twice on the Fenwick cluster. To inspect compaction offsets directly, connect to the metadata store using the credentials below.

primary connection of baweg-kahop = mysql://eliox_svc:Z0@db-4ab3.urlaqstack.local:5432/oliok

### Q: Which firmware update channel should reviewed changes target?

All reviewed changes for Lumenpost devices must merge to the `staging` channel first; `stable` promotions require a signed rollout manifest and a soak period of 72 hours. Never approve a direct-to-stable patch, even for hotfixes. For manifest signing questions or channel policy exceptions, contact the Firmware Release desk.

escalation mailbox, bafog-fafog: ulador@paliqlabs.internal